About the author

Allen Hutt

26 books6 followers
George Allen Hutt (1901 - 1973) was a journalist, Marxist social historian, and authority on newspaper typography and design. He was the chief sub-editor on the Communist newspaper The Daily Worker for 24 years until 1966; member of the National Union of Journalists from 1926 until his death; and author of Newspaper Design (1960; 2nd ed. 1967) and The Changing Newspaper (1973). Hutt was a consultant on matters of design to many national and provincial newspapers. He was made a Royal Designer for Industry (RDI) in 1970.
